The Marshall Thundering Herd and the FIU Panthers meet in college basketball action from the Ocean Bank Convocation Center on Thursday night.

The Marshall Thundering Herd will look to bounce back from an 87-77 loss to Rice last time out. Taevion Kinsey leads the Herd in scoring with 20.5 PPG along with 5.4 RPG and 4.4 APG while Obinna Anochili-Killen has 13.3 PPG and a team-high 6.8 RPG to lead Marshall on the glass. Andrew Taylor has 12.3 PPG with 5.8 RPG and a team-high 4.5 APG to lead the Herd in assists and round out the group of double-digit scorers for Marshall so far this season. Darius George also has 8.6 PPG and 5.4 RPG as well this season. As a team, Marshall is averaging 76.1 PPG on 43.7% shooting from the field, 27.2% from three and 69.5% from the foul line while allowing 76.6 PPG on 44.5% shooting from the field and 35.1% from three this season.

The FIU Panthers will try to rebound from a 50-39 loss to Middle Tennessee last time out. Tevin Brewer leads FIU in scoring and assists with 15 PPG and 5.8 APG along with 4.1 RPG while and Denver Jones has 12.2 PPG with 3.9 RPG and 2.6 APG to cap off the scoring in double figures for FIU so far this season. Clevon Brown also has 7.8 PPG with a team-high 5.8 RPG to lead the Panthers on the glass this year. As a team, FIU is averaging 71.9 PPG on 42.1% shooting from the field, 33.9% from three and 69.3% from the foul line while allowing 67.2 PPG on 40% shooting from the field and 30.2% from three this season.

Marshall is 7-18-3 ATS in their last 28 games overall and 1-5 ATS in their last 6 road games while the under is 4-0 in their last 4 Thursday games. FIU is 5-11 ATS in their last 16 home games and 7-21-1 ATS in their last 29 games overall while the under is 4-1 in their last 5 games following a loss.
